Us Renal Care Amarillo Dialysis is a medicare approved dialysis facility center in Amarillo, Texas and it has 16 dialysis stations. It is located in Potter county at 1915 S Coulter Street, Amarillo, TX, 79106. You can reach out to the office of Us Renal Care Amarillo Dialysis at (806) 355-3310. This dialysis clinic is managed and/or owned by Us Renal Care, Inc.. Us Renal Care Amarillo Dialysis has the following ownership type - Profit. It was first certified by medicare in October, 2009. The medicare id for this facility is 672614 and it accepts patients under medicare ESRD program.

Adult patinets who undergo hemodialysis, their Kt/V should be atleast 1.2 and for peritoneal dialysis the Kt/V should be atleast 1.7, that means they are receiving right amount of dialysis. Pediatric patients who undergo hemodialysis, their Kt/V should be atleast 1.2 and for peritoneal dialysis the Kt/V should be 1.8.
Higher percentages should be better.

The arteriovenous (AV) fistulae is considered long term vascular access for hemodialysis because it allows good blood flow, lasts a long time, and is less likely to get infected or cause blood clots than other types of access. Patients who don't have time to get a permanent vascular access before they start hemodialysis treatments may need to use a venous catheter as a temporary access.
